Purchase Risks Performance Risk Won’t func?on/solve as intended
Financial Risk Monetary loss if product fails (services higher risk than products)
Time Loss Risk Customer’s ?me due to failure
Opportunity Risk Choosing one product over another
![Page 11: Accounting Today Pricing Session](https://reader034.vdocument.in/reader034/viewer/2022051817/547d45fdb4af9fa5158b52da/html5/thumbnails/11.jpg)
Purchase Risks
Psychological/Social Risk Purchase won’t fit customer’s self-‐concept. (Restaurants, cars, stylists, cosme?c surgery, etc.)
Physical Risk Chance purchase will cause physical harm (medical care, Michelin ?re ads)

8 Steps to Pricing on Purpose ① Conversa?on with customer ② Present to value council ③ Value council ques?ons,
develops op?ons ④ Present op?ons to customer ⑤ Op?on selected is codified
into an FPA ⑥ Proper project management ⑦ Any scope creep, use change
requests ⑧ Perform AWer Ac?on Reviews
![Page 19: Accounting Today Pricing Session](https://reader034.vdocument.in/reader034/viewer/2022051817/547d45fdb4af9fa5158b52da/html5/thumbnails/19.jpg)
Step 1: Conversation
• Listen > Talk • Focus on wants, needs and value
Opening: “Chris, we will only undertake this
engagement if we can mutually agree that the value we are creating is greater than the price we are charging you. Is that acceptable?”

Step 5: FPA = Scope Doc • Objec?ves, deliverables • Constraints, assump?ons • Project structure, ?meline & milestones • Scope details, func?onal requirements • Roles & team defini?ons (detail customer’s responsibili?es too)
• Establish parameters for change request (aka project change control)
• Future projects list (i.e. what is NOT included) • Approval
![Page 24: Accounting Today Pricing Session](https://reader034.vdocument.in/reader034/viewer/2022051817/547d45fdb4af9fa5158b52da/html5/thumbnails/24.jpg)
Steps 6,7 & 8: Part of Work! • Project management developing a core competency
• Scope creep management crea?ng processes, providing training
• AWer Ac?on Reviews if we don’t act differently based on our learnings, we miss the opportunity to improve quality, profitability, everything…

Review • Turn pricing into a core competency • Appoint a Value Council and/or CVO • Develop project management skills • Maintain minimum prices, offer op?ons • Price EVERYTHING up-‐front, use phasing • Employ Change Requests • Don’t treat all buyers equally • Don’t use “?me” as your basis for pricing, instead, align w/customer objec?ves (KPIs)
• Learn from your AARs for con?nuous improvement
